The Importance of Sunscreen

Sunscreen is not just a summer accessory; it's a crucial part of your daily skincare routine. UV rays can lead to premature aging, skin damage, and even skin cancer. Dermatologists emphasize the need for broad-spectrum protection, which shields against both UVA and UVB rays. What to Look for in a Sunscreen

When selecting a sunscreen, consider the following key factors:

  • SPF Rating: Look for a sunscreen with at least SPF 30 for adequate protection.

  • Broad-Spectrum Protection: Ensure it protects against both UVA and UVB rays.

  • Skin Type Compatibility: Choose a formulation that suits your skin type, whether oily, dry, or sensitive.

  • Water Resistance: If you plan to swim or sweat, opt for water-resistant formulas.

Understanding Different Formulations

There are several types of sunscreen formulations to consider:

  • Creams: Great for dry skin, providing hydration and protection.

  • Gels: Lightweight options that are perfect for oily skin types.

  • Sprays: Convenient for on-the-go application, especially for body use.

  • Sticks: Ideal for targeted application on the face and sensitive areas.

How to Apply Sunscreen Effectively

Applying sunscreen correctly is just as important as choosing the right product. Here’s how to ensure you’re getting the maximum benefit:

  • Apply Generously: Use about a shot glass size for your body and a nickel-sized amount for your face.

  • Reapply Regularly: Reapply every two hours, or immediately after swimming or sweating.

  • Don’t Forget Areas: Pay attention to often-missed areas like the ears, back of the neck, and tops of the feet.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use sunscreen on my face and body?

Yes, but it’s best to choose products specifically formulated for the face to avoid breakouts or irritation.

How often should I apply sunscreen?

Reapply every two hours, or more frequently if you are swimming or sweating.

Is it necessary to wear sunscreen on cloudy days?

Absolutely! UV rays can penetrate clouds, so wearing sunscreen is essential regardless of the weather.

What is the difference between physical and chemical sunscreens?

Physical sunscreens contain active mineral ingredients that sit on top of the skin and block UV rays, while chemical sunscreens absorb UV radiation and convert it to heat.
